High-weight plantar fasciitis insoles require specific arch support and durable materials

The Welnove insoles target a specific niche: individuals over 220 lbs needing structured orthotic support for plantar fasciitis and pronation. Unlike generic cushioning, these are designed for work boots and running shoes, indicating a focus on high-impact environments. Buyers should understand that effective relief requires firm arch support and deep heel cups, not just soft padding.

Key Considerations Before Buying

  • Weight capacity is critical; at 220+ lbs, the insole's structural integrity and material density must prevent premature compression and maintain its corrective shape.
  • Footwear compatibility is non-negotiable; an orthotic for work boots requires a different profile and thickness than one for standard sneakers to avoid crowding.
  • The 'high arch support' claim must translate to a rigid or semi-rigid arch that actively resists collapse to combat overpronation and distribute weight off the plantar fascia.

What Our Analysts Recommend

Quality indicators include a contoured, non-flat heel seat to stabilize the calcaneus and a pronounced longitudinal arch that doesn't soften under pressure. For this weight class, look for mentions of multi-layer construction, often with a firm base layer, to ensure durability. Genuine reviews will specifically note changes in pain levels during standing or after the first few miles, not just initial comfort.

Common Issues

Common failures include arch supports that flatten within weeks under high load, materials that cause excessive heat or odor, and insoles that are too thick for the intended footwear, altering fit and causing new pressure points. For plantar fasciitis, improper arch placement can exacerbate rather than alleviate pain.

Quality Indicators

Identify quality through material descriptions: look for terms like 'semi-rigid polypropylene shell,' 'porous top cover for moisture management,' and 'deep heel cradle.' Authentic positive reviews will detail a break-in period and sustained improvement, not instant, miraculous cures.
